A Look at Cisco Systems's (CSCO) Valuation After Recent Share Price Gains
Cisco Systems (CSCO) shares have seen notable movement over the past month, climbing 7% even as the broader tech sector has experienced mixed results. Investors are looking closely at what might be driving these gains and how they compare to Cisco's longer-term performance.
See our latest analysis for Cisco Systems.
Cisco’s strong 30-day share price return of 6.6% and a year-to-date climb of nearly 29% suggest momentum is building, as investors have responded positively to solid recent earnings and consistent profitability. Looking at the bigger picture, Cisco’s 1-year total shareholder return of 31.6% and 67% over three years highlight its ability to reward long-term holders even as competition in the tech space remains intense.

Most Popular Narrative: 10% Undervalued
At $76.07 per share, Cisco Systems is trading below the narrative's fair value estimate, which could indicate room for potential upside if expectations are met. With enthusiasm stemming from projected growth in networking and AI infrastructure, market watchers are focused on the factors underpinning this view.
Enterprises and governments are in a sustained cycle of digitizing operations. Cisco is seeing widespread adoption of refreshed networking (Cat9k, smart switches, ruggedized industrial IoT) and security products across industries. This digital transformation trend is expected to support steady order growth and recurring revenue acceleration, reinforcing both top-line and earnings visibility.
